Since its maiden voyage in 2000, the Explorer of the Seas has consistently elevated the cruise experience with its ingenious design and comprehensive suite of amenities. Benefiting from significant enhancements in 2015, this Voyager-class liner from Royal Caribbean International captivates with a harmonious mix of adventure and relaxation. Accommodating up to 3,286 guests with a dedicated crew of 1,180, it serves a wide spectrum of preferences, offering a range of pricing that caters to both budget-savvy passengers and those desiring luxury.

The Explorer of the Seas stands out with its thrilling attractions like the FlowRider surf simulator and the Perfect Storm water slides, Cyclone and Typhoon, making aquatic excitement accessible to enthusiasts of all ages. Yet, it gracefully shifts gears to tranquility, offering peaceful retreats such as the adults-only Solarium and the rejuvenating Vitality Spa. Dining aboard the Explorer transforms into a captivating journey, boasting an array of choices from the complimentary Windjammer Marketplace and Sapphire Dining Room to upscale culinary experiences at specialty restaurants like Chops Grille and Giovanni's Table.

The entertainment selection aboard is nothing short of spectacular, ranging from ice-skating performances in Studio B to vibrant deck parties and captivating shows at the Palace Theater. This rich diversity in entertainment and dining firmly establishes the ship as a prime choice for a broad audience, including families, couples, and solo travelers, adept at shifting its ambiance from lively during the day to elegant and serene by night.

Pros

  • Dynamic onboard activities including the FlowRider and Perfect Storm slides cater to all ages.
  • The Royal Promenade offers a vibrant and interactive shopping, dining, and entertainment experience.
  • Diverse dining options, from casual to specialty restaurants, accommodate a variety of tastes and preferences.
  • Explorer of the Seas' upgrades and amenities maintain a modern vibe despite its older build date.

Cons

  • High passenger capacity can lead to crowding and queues, especially during peak times.
  • Lacks the newest and most innovative features found on Royal Caribbean's latest ships.
  • Some areas may show wear or feel outdated compared to newer fleet members.
  • Additional charges for specialty dining, activities, and services can add up quickly.

Tips

  • Book activities like the FlowRider and ice skating in advance to ensure availability.
  • Visit the Windjammer during off-peak times to avoid the busiest crowds.
  • Explore the ship on embarkation day to familiarize yourself with locations and lesser-known spots.
  • Attend the must-see ice skating shows early to get a good seat, as they're highly popular.
  • Use the Royal Promenade for more than just a thoroughfare; it's a hub of activity and hidden gems.
  • Check for dining package deals online before your cruise to save on specialty restaurants.
  • If sensitive to noise, request a cabin away from the Royal Promenade to ensure quieter evenings.
  • Stay connected with the ship's Wi-Fi packages, but purchase before embarking for the best deals.
  • Take advantage of the ship's app to keep track of daily activities and manage your itinerary.
  • For a quieter pool experience, spend time in the adults-only Solarium area.
